Why Exhaust Header Gasket Material Is Necessary

From my experience, exhaust header gasket material is necessary because it helps create a tight seal between the exhaust header and the engine. I’ve seen how small gaps in this area can quickly lead to exhaust leaks, which cause noise, loss of performance, and sometimes even a burning smell. A good gasket material fills those uneven surfaces and keeps hot exhaust gases where they belong.

I also find that this material is important because exhaust systems deal with extreme heat and constant vibration. My engine expands and contracts as it runs, so the gasket has to stay strong and flexible enough to handle that movement. Without the right gasket material, the connection can loosen over time and cause repeated problems.

For me, using the proper exhaust header gasket material is a simple way to improve reliability. It protects the engine, supports better exhaust flow, and helps prevent costly repairs later. In my opinion, it’s a small part that makes a big difference in how well the whole system performs.

My Buying Guides on Exhaust Header Gasket Material

When I shop for an exhaust header gasket, I don’t just look at the price or the brand name. I focus on the material first, because that choice has the biggest impact on heat resistance, sealing performance, durability, and how often I’ll need to replace it. Over time, I’ve learned that the right gasket material can save me from leaks, annoying ticking sounds, and repeated repairs.

1. Why Gasket Material Matters

From my experience, the gasket material determines how well the header seals against the engine. Exhaust systems deal with extreme heat, vibration, and pressure changes, so a weak material can fail quickly. I always choose a material that can handle high temperatures without crushing, burning, or blowing out.

2. Common Exhaust Header Gasket Materials

Multi-Layer Steel (MLS)

I like MLS gaskets when I want strong durability and a reliable seal. They are made from thin layers of steel and usually perform well under high heat and pressure. In my view, they are a great choice for performance engines and long-term use.

Graphite

Graphite gaskets are one of the materials I often see recommended for excellent sealing. I appreciate that they can conform well to slight surface imperfections. However, I’ve found they may wear out faster if the header surface is rough or the installation is not done carefully.

Composite

Composite gaskets are usually more affordable, and I’ve used them when I needed a budget-friendly option. They can work fine for mild applications, but I don’t rely on them as much for high-performance or high-heat setups.

Copper

Copper gaskets stand out to me because of their heat resistance and reusability. I like them for demanding applications, especially when I need something that can handle severe conditions. That said, I make sure the surfaces are very clean and flat before installing one.

Fiber or Non-Asbestos Materials

These are lighter-duty options in my experience. I consider them for basic applications, but I avoid them when I expect a lot of heat or stress. They simply don’t give me the same confidence as metal-based options.

3. Match the Material to Your Vehicle

I always think about how I use my vehicle before choosing a gasket. If I’m driving a daily commuter, I may not need the most expensive material. But if I’m running a performance build, towing, or dealing with higher exhaust temperatures, I prefer a tougher material like MLS or copper.

4. Consider Heat Resistance

Heat resistance is one of the first things I check. Exhaust headers can get extremely hot, so I want a gasket material that won’t degrade quickly. In my experience, metal-based gaskets usually outperform softer materials in this area.

5. Look at Surface Compatibility

I’ve learned that even the best gasket material won’t perform well if the mating surfaces are uneven or damaged. Some materials, like graphite, can help with minor imperfections, while others, like copper or MLS, need a cleaner, flatter surface to seal properly.

6. Think About Reusability

If I expect to remove the headers again later, I pay attention to whether the gasket can be reused. Copper gaskets often appeal to me for this reason, while composite and fiber gaskets are usually more of a one-time-use option.

7. Don’t Ignore Installation Quality

No matter which material I choose, I know installation matters just as much. I always use the correct torque sequence, check bolt tightness after heat cycles, and make sure the surfaces are clean. A great gasket material can still fail if I install it poorly.

8. Balance Price and Performance

I don’t always buy the most expensive gasket, but I also avoid going too cheap. I’ve found that a slightly better material often gives me better sealing and longer life, which saves money in the long run.

9. My Final Buying Tip

If I want the safest all-around choice, I usually lean toward MLS or copper for performance and durability. For a standard street vehicle, graphite can be a solid option if the surfaces are in good condition. I choose based on heat, fit, and how long I expect the gasket to last.
